White-on-White Bathroom: How to Make It Work for You



The color palette you choose for your bathroom can significantly affect its look and atmosphere. Some fear using a white-on-white scheme, thinking their space might feel too sterile or cold. However, the right approach can transform your bathroom into a serene and sophisticated sanctuary. Focus on Exceptional Fixtures

An all-white bathroom is the perfect canvas to showcase stunning fixtures. Choose faucets, showerheads and cabinet hardware with unique finishes like matte black, brushed gold or even polished chrome to make a statement. These elements can serve as the room’s jewelry, adding that touch of luxury and personality.

Embrace Textures and Patterns

The magic of a white-on-white bathroom lies in its texture. Sleek marble countertops, textured tiles or even wood accents can add warmth and interest to the room. Let in Natural Light

With plenty of natural light, your bathroom will look more open and airier. You can let the light in while maintaining privacy with frosted or tinted windows. Skylights are another excellent way to flood your space with sunshine. 

Add Layers of Lighting

Adequate lighting can accentuate the white surfaces, making the bathroom look spacious and welcoming. The right mix of ambient, task and accent lighting can help you achieve balanced illumination. Consider installing dimmable LED recessed lights for a soft glow or stylish pendant lights for a modern touch. 

Incorporate Soft Elements

To break the monotony, introduce soft elements like plush white towels, a chic bathmat or even a fabric shower curtain with subtle patterns. They can add layers and texture and turn your bathroom into a cozy retreat. You can also incorporate live plants to add a pop of color and freshness to the room.
